About Backtracking

Backtracking systematically explores all possible solutions by building candidates incrementally and abandoning paths that cannot lead to a valid solution. These problems cover permutations, combinations, subsets, N-Queens, and Sudoku solving, testing your ability to prune search spaces efficiently.

Practice 5 interactive coding problems with step-by-step execution visualization.

Backtracking

Practice Backtracking problems

Problems5 problems